Output 6c26fcfaba4e9cc0ca0409bf7bc3673c459fd989c231573785321388a43fd59a:71

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 57774590f5aa77b4f732ee1d7d7194788f21578bb5a74af64a03d6ea70054bf3
address
bc1p2am5ty844fmmfaejacwh6uv50z8jz4utkkn54aj2q0tw5uq9f0es9pm6a8
transaction
6c26fcfaba4e9cc0ca0409bf7bc3673c459fd989c231573785321388a43fd59a
spent
true